John Yount b. 1806 - Upper Saucon, Lehigh Co., PA
The 1850 Census for Upper Saucon, Lehigh Co., PA contains the following listing:
John Youndt age 44 b.1806 PA
Sarah Youndt age 44 b. 1806 PA
Elizabeth Youndt age 22 b. 1828 PA
Susanna Youndt age 20 b. 1830 PA
Joseph Youndt age 18 b. 1832 PA
Mary Youndt age 14 b. 1836 PA
Sarah Youndt age 10 b. 1840 PA
This same family can be found in the Census listings for the same location under John Young in 1830, John Yundt in 1840, John Youndt in 1850, John Yount in 1860, John Yundt in 1870, and John Youndt in 1880.
George C. Yount b. 1744 with his wife Eva Catherine Knauss b. 1750 and their family settled in this area of Northampton Co. which was later to become Lehigh County before 1772. They had 5 sons namely John b. 1774, Daniel b. 1776, Abraham b. 1780, George C. b. 1784 and Henry b. 1788. George C. Yount's descendants are listed under Yound,Youndt,Yond,Yount etc. in the Census listings for Lehigh Co. for the period 1830 to 1860 and to my knowledge are the only Yount families to live in this County during this time. Although none of George C. Yount's descendants actually lived in Upper Saucon Twp. it still seems logical that the John Yount b. 1806 that did live there must be related. I have reviewed the family trees for all of George C. Yount's sons and there is no place in them or in the Census listings of these Yount families for a John Yount b. 1806 to fit in.
